Toggle Filter
Pet Food

Nom Nom Fresh food for dogs

  • 2 years ago
  • nsubashd
  • United States (USA), California

Nom Nom .We’re a team of pet scholars, virtuosos, polyglots and plain old obsessives. Everywhere from our kitchens to our research labs to our corporate…

Sell
770 Views
On Call